逼車

逼車()是指與前車緊貼的嚴重危險駕駛行為。

成因
逼車的成因有多種:

阻礙切線
駕駛者可能會緊貼前車以阻止其他車輛切入自己的車道,迫使後車減速並跟隨在自己後方行駛。這種行為可能會引起其他駕駛者的不滿,或會觸發路怒症。

疏忽
駕駛者可能因疏忽而無意中逼車,對這種行為的潛在風險沒有足夠的認識,或是過度高估自己的駕駛技術和汽車的性能。

路怒症
在駕駛過程中,一些駕駛者會因情緒失控而表現出極端的駕駛行為,例如緊貼前車駕駛強迫前方車輛讓行或加速。他們在情緒激動時,容易因小事而變得暴躁,並通過逼車來發泄怒氣,這樣的行為極具危險性。
